Based on her own successful courses and workshops, Claire Watson Garcia's Drawing for the Absolute and Utter Beginner gives novice artists the tools to make competent, often eloquent drawings.

Using a positive, accepting tone that teaches "how to find what works" as a practical skill, Garcia presents a series of progressive lessons that gradually introduces readers to essential drawing skills: recording edges; creating dimension; adding accuracy; developing and expanding values with pencil, pen, charcoal, Conte, and wash; balancing compositional elements; and drawing the human face, both frontal and profile views.

The goals set by each chapter are within the reach of every beginner, and satisfy and encourage readers by enabling them to create a reasonable likeness of an object and to give it the appearance of spatial depth. The book recreates a classroom setting by including artwork and tips for success from beginnind students who have worked on the same materil, which gives readers a realistic context in which to constructively assess their work and confirm their successes. Paperback, 160 pages, 230 black-and-white illustrations.
